Symmetry in Relativistic Measurements

The covarying scale effect in the observational relativistic measurement found a few years ago is that the Lorentz factor is a scale conversion ratio between the virtual covarying scale of measurement in relative motion and the real invariant scale at rest with respect to the observer. We find this scale conversion ratio being the bridge between two relative frames, and a logical symmetry for the measurement of the spatial distance and the measurement of time interval by using the same scale conversion. Hence the two relative frames are not only reciprocal to each other, but also symmetric with respect to the scale conversion to each other.
